 * Hi!
 * The website I manage has recently been attacked through the malware IOptimize.
   For about a week now (first occurrence seems to have been October 13th), all 
   kinds of corrupted files have been uploaded to my webspace. The website itself
   has always been perfectly fine and is still usable. After I got alerted by the
   webhoster, I first changed all the passwords. But the suspicious uploads continued
   and today I was not able to use the admin dashboard anymore (basically, all styling
   is lost and all of the links lead to Error 403 Forbidden). Now I have deleted
   all uploaded files I could find and tried to reset htaccess and index.php. However,
   the problem persists: the website works fine, but I cannot edit it anymore or
   access anything in the admin dashboard. For the worst case, I do have a backup(
   five months old, but that would not be tragic), but what else can I do to get
   the backend going again?

 * Hm, it looks like completely deleting the .htaccess has solved the issue for 
   now. I will go through some more steps to make sure this does not happen again!
